A simple synthesis of benzofurans by acid-catalyzed domino reaction of salicyl alcohols with N-tosylfurfurylamine

A simple route to polysubstituted benzofurans based on the domino reaction of commercial or easily available salicyl alcohols with N-protected furfurylamine has been designed and developed. The reaction was found to proceed with reasonable yields under heating of substrates in acetic acid in the presence of catalytic amount of conc. HCl when tosyl was used as protecting group.
